NEUROB-SR 40 Tablet is commonly prescribed to manage anxiety and control tremors. It also plays a role in preventing migraines, reducing chest pain caused by heart conditions (angina), and managing bleeding due to elevated pressure in the liver (portal hypertension).
Additionally, NEUROB-SR 40 Tablet is effective in treating high blood pressure and irregular heart rhythms (arrhythmias). The dosage varies depending on your medical condition and how your body reacts to the medication. It should always be taken according to your doctor’s instructions—ideally on an empty stomach and at the same time daily. Even if you feel better, do not stop taking it abruptly without medical advice, as this can worsen your condition.
Common side effects may include fatigue, weakness, cold hands and feet (Raynaud’s phenomenon), a slow or irregular heartbeat, and difficulty breathing. Other symptoms like nausea, vomiting, or diarrhea may occur as well. These side effects usually subside as your body adjusts, but consult your doctor if they persist or become troublesome.
This medicine should be avoided in individuals with asthma, severe heart rhythm disorders, or serious heart failure. Those with liver or kidney conditions or chronic respiratory illnesses like COPD should use it with caution. Avoid alcohol while on this medication, as it can alter its effects. If the medicine causes dizziness, avoid driving or operating machinery. Always consult your healthcare provider before using this medicine during pregnancy or breastfeeding.

How to Use NEUROB-SR 40 Tablet
Take the medication exactly as prescribed. Swallow it whole with water—do not chew or crush. For best results, take it on an empty stomach, preferably at the same time each day.
⚠️ Avoid taking it with high-fat meals such as chocolate, butter, meat, seeds, or oils, as these can affect its absorption.
How NEUROB-SR 40 Tablet Works
NEUROB-SR 40 Tablet contains Propranolol, a beta-blocker. It functions by blocking the effects of certain stress hormones like adrenaline, thereby reducing heart rate and easing the workload on the heart. This improves blood flow and helps manage angina, migraines, and irregular heart rhythms.
In anxiety and tremor control, it calms the body's overactive stress response. Though its exact mechanism for reducing tremors isn't fully understood, it's believed to limit excessive nerve activity that causes muscle shaking. In cases of pheochromocytoma (a rare tumor of the adrenal glands), it helps reduce the risk of high blood pressure during surgery.
Safety Advice
Alcohol:- Unsafe – Avoid alcohol as it can interfere with the effects of NEUROB-SR 40 Tablet.
Pregnancy:- Use only under medical supervision. This medicine may not be safe during pregnancy. Discuss the risks and benefits with your doctor.
Breastfeeding:- Caution is advised. Limited data suggests that the drug may pass into breast milk and could affect the baby. Consult your doctor before use.
Driving:- If you experience dizziness, blurred vision, or fatigue, avoid driving or using machinery.
Kidney:- Use with caution in individuals with kidney issues. Your doctor may adjust your dose accordingly.
Liver:- Patients with liver conditions should take this medicine under close monitoring. Dosage adjustments may be required.
Missed a Dose? :- If you forget to take NEUROB-SR 40 Tablet, take it as soon as you remember. If it's close to your next scheduled dose, skip the missed one and continue with your routine. Never double the dose to make up for a missed one.
